
Sica Leroux RMT Bio
Sica graduated from Vancouver College of Massage Therapy where she had the privilege of working with talented and passionate instructors. There she learned the art and science of being an RMT and further developed her intuition.
Sica has experience working with pregnant women, infants, athletes (cyclists, rock climbers, MMA fighters, runners and dancers), TMJ Disorder, headaches, Carpal Tunnel Syndrome, chronic pain and general stress. Using a combination of deep tissue, trigger point, Craniosacral and fascial modalities, Sica focuses her treatments on relaxation and nervous system regulation. You may experience the wonderful world of “the floaties” during a session.
Listing off a few of the techniques Sica has added to her tool belt: Womb care for third trimester (Mandy Verghese), Trauma Imprint Repair for babies, children and adults (Jamie Lee Mock, Kari Toft), Craniosacral (Kari Toft), Breathwork (Robin Clements), IASTM (Prohealthsys), and Yoga for Remedial Exercises (Leigh Anne Milne).
Before becoming an RMT Sica spent over twenty years studying acting, body language and expression, movement and dance. Combining travel and education, she has her Personal Training certification from WYN in Melbourne, Australia and 200 hours Yoga Teacher Training from Wise Living Yoga Academy in Thailand. Sica integrates subtle movements, breath and mind-body connection from these studies into her remedial exercises while encouraging you to take care of your health.
